> Penetration Aid
> Each missile in this rack carries spoofers, jammers, radar targets,
> etc, to attract attention from PDS and help the "real" missiles get
> through.  Acts as a Screen-1 for all missiles within 6".  Reduce the
> effective radius by 1" for each missile hit by PDS fire.

I like this one too.  Given the fact that you're giving up the combat
potential for a missile salvo, these could have the same cost as the
standard missile salvos.  Since the protection provided is minimal,
these
would be used for massed missile shots.  Three salvos of standard
warheads
has equivalent damage probabilities as two standard with one ECM salvo.
